The Future of Urban Real Estate
The evolving landscape of urban housing is set to witness significant alteration in the next years. Rising demand for walkable neighborhoods, coupled with technological advancements, will influence how dwellings are created and inhabited. We foresee a greater focus on sustainable construction, versatile areas, and community-centric features. Furthermore, virtual work is expected to remain impacting transportation patterns and reorganizing interest across city regions.
Navigating the Current Housing Market
The current housing market is proving challenging to maneuver for both purchasers and vendors . Higher borrowing costs are dampening demand, while a paucity of listed properties continues to support prices . It’s a intricate situation, requiring careful analysis and potentially the guidance of a real estate advisor to arrive at informed choices .

Initial Homebuyer Tips and Tricks
Buying your first residence can feel daunting, but with a bit planning, it doesn't have to be! Commence by meticulously assessing your budgetary situation – understand your credit and savings. Afterward, investigate different home financing alternatives and get pre-approved to determine how much you can borrow. Don't speeding the journey; take your time to discover a suitable neighborhood and inspect possible properties completely. Finally, evaluate collaborating with a knowledgeable real estate representative who can assist you through the full purchase.
Maximizing Your Rental Property Income
To increase your lease income, consider several key strategies. Setting the lease rate is typically the first step, but examine the neighborhood market to confirm you're competitive . Beyond that, putting in minor renovations – like new paint or stylish fixtures – can significantly improve its desirability to qualified tenants, eventually producing a greater income flow . Also, careful tenant selection minimizes vacancy and reduces costly repairs down the line.
